Abstract

This study aims to determine the income disparity of dairy cattle entrepreneurs in Pacet Village, Pacet District, Mojokerto Regency. This research method uses a descriptive quantitative method using primary data, the data used is a questionnaire obtained from respondents of dairy cattle entrepreneurs. The data analysis tool in this study is the gini ratio. The results of this study can be explained that the total % of income in class in the first class is 0.86%, the second class is 0.14%, the third class is 0.20%, the fourth class is 0.26%, the fifth class is 0,32% with a total percent of income of 100%. And it can also be explained that there is cumulative income in the first class of 0.08%, the second class is 0.23%, the third class is 0.42%, the fourth class is 0.68% and the fifth class is 100%. Then, the value of the gini coefficient (gini ratio) using the five-class method is 0.232, it can be seen that the level of inequality of dairy cattle entrepreneurs in Pacet Village, Pacet District, Mojokerto Regency is in the category of low income inequality.
